Little things about the Ortakoy mosque: Official - Medzhidiya Mosque, built in the 19th century by order of Sultan Abdulmecid. The style is Ottoman Baroque, and the decoration is straight out of the water and is one of the most photogenic mosques in the world.

It is especially beautiful at sunset, when the Bosporus shines with the light of the minarets.
